Call Button Operations
Call-In Priorities
Each speaker in a room can be equipped with up to three call-in switches. Each call-in
switch is programmed with a priority level. Priority 1 is the highest, 6 is the lowest, and 7
is used to cancel the call. By default, call-in switch 1 is programmed as a normal call (pri
-
ority 5), call-in switch 2 is programmed as emergency 2 (priority 2), and call-in switch 3
is programmed as call cancel (priority 7). The priorities are listed below.
1. Emergency 1 (E1)
2. Emergency 2 (E2)
3. Emergency 3 (E3)
4. High Priority (HP)
5. Normal Priority (NP)
6. Low Priority (LP)
7. Cancel
Placing a Call-In
Placing a Normal Call-In
Press and release the CALL button on a non-emergency priority call-in switch.
Placing an Emergency Call-In
Press and release the CALL button on a designated emergency call-in switch.
—OR—
Rapidly press and release the CALL button twice on a non-emergency priority call-in
switch (this must enabled by System programming).
Upgrading a Normal Call-In to Emergency
Press and release the CALL button on a designated emergency call-in switch associated
with the call-in switch that originated the normal call-in.
—OR—
Rapidly press and release the CALL button twice on the same normal call-in switch that
originated the call (this must enabled by System programming).
